Final Days of our Explore! After School Program

The last two weeks of school passed us all by so quickly. Despite time winding down, we were still able to pack in so much fun over our final days. On Tuesday, May 21st, Muncie Community Schools held their last early-release day for the school year. Early-release days mean more time in after school programming. When this last early-release comes around each year, that means sprinkler day at the Ross Community Center!

Sprinklers are always fun, and we were so fortunate to have the perfect weather for them that day! We also got to take a popsicle break at the end, which just feels like a perfect ending to the day.

Another favorite activity item is shaving cream! There’s so many different ways to use this simple material and the students always love it. While we didn’t get any pictures of the activity, which was marbling paper using washable paint and shaving cream, we did get this classic picture of student living their best life with the shaving cream after the fun of using the paper had passed.

Over the course of the last several weeks, we also had an ongoing project based learning activity that was designing and building your own water park attraction. We had some lazy rivers, quite a few slides, and one student spent so much time building this giant pool with it’s own pool floats. We had to share it with you.

Lastly, we wrapped up the week with the students helping us decorate items for our upcoming Ice Cream Social on Saturday, June 8th from 2pm-5pm (we hope you’ll join us for this free event!); and an epic glow party on the last day of school! We are really going to miss our students this summer, but we hope everyone has a wonderful break!
